“A former lawyer and a significant donor to the Democratic Party who also held a fundraiser for President Joe Biden has been indicted on multiple federal charges, including embezzling money from clients,” Conservative Brief reported.
According to a Justice Department news release, federal grand juries in two states charged Tom Girardi, 83, for allegedly embezzling more than $18 million from customers. The agency added that he was charged with five charges of wire fraud in Los Angeles, which carries a potential jail sentence of 20 years. Fox News stated that prosecutors claimed the allegations “were part of an indictment accusing him of embezzling more than $15 million from clients and using the funds to cover his law firm’s payroll and pay his personal expenses.”
“The case also includes charges against Christopher Kamon, the former chief financial officer of Girardi’s LA-based law firm, Girardi Keese, indicating they ‘devised, participated in, and executed a scheme to defraud victim clients’ until the firm collapsed in late 2020,” Fox News noting further, adding:
Girardi, his son-in-law David Lira, and Kamon were charged with eight charges of wire fraud and four counts of contempt of court in Chicago. Prosecutors suspect that the trio misappropriated over $3 million in compensation monies intended for the families of those killed in a Boeing aircraft disaster off the coast of Indonesia.
Girardi was one of the most renowned attorneys in Los Angeles until being disbarred in disgrace in California last year, and Wednesday’s indictments represent the latest chapter in his dramatic fall.
